Village Overview

Chak Raipur is a village in Mohammad Bazar Block, also recorded as a Census sub-district, Birbhum district, West Bengal. For Chak Raipur, the population is 2,573, PIN code is 731216 and Census village code is 316759. Location and Administration

Chak Raipur comes under Chak Raipur gram panchayat and Mohammad Bazar C.D. Block. Its local administrative unit is Mohammad Bazar Block, also recorded as a Census sub-district. The block headquarters is Patalnagar at 16.10 km. The Census district headquarters, Suri, is Not reported away.

Population Profile

The population details below are from Census 2011 village records. They help you understand the size of Chak Raipur village and its household count.

Total population

2,573 residents in 510 households

Male population

1,275

Female population

1,298

SC/ST population

Scheduled Castes: 4; Scheduled Tribes: 1,366

Agriculture and Land Use

Land-use area is reported in hectares using Census village directory land-use categories such as net area sown, irrigated area, forest, fallow land and non-agricultural use. This is useful for general village research, farming context and local area study.

Agriculture and land-use records for Chak Raipur
Net area sown393.96 hectares
Irrigated area133.43 hectares
Unirrigated area260.53 hectares
Wells / tube wells irrigated area42.38 hectares
Tanks / lakes irrigated area91.05 hectares
Non-agricultural area118.30 hectares
Main cropJute
